Aanwali Population - Sonipat, Haryana

Aanwali is a large village located in Gohana Tehsil of Sonipat district, Haryana with total 848 families residing. The Aanwali village has population of 4337 of which 2413 are males while 1924 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Aanwali village population of children with age 0-6 is 449 which makes up 10.35 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Aanwali village is 797 which is lower than Haryana state average of 879. Child Sex Ratio for the Aanwali as per census is 782, lower than Haryana average of 834.

Aanwali village has higher literacy rate compared to Haryana. In 2011, literacy rate of Aanwali village was 78.29 % compared to 75.55 % of Haryana. In Aanwali Male literacy stands at 87.92 % while female literacy rate was 66.24 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 14.48 % of total population in Aanwali village. The village Aanwali curr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Aanwali village out of total population, 2046 were engaged in work activities. 56.01 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 43.99 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 2046 workers engaged in Main Work, 489 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 165 were Agricultural labourer.
